240114321 ENTREPRISE INNOVATION AND ENTREPRENEURSHIP ( 3 Crd.Hrs )

This interactive course gives students an introduction to the basic concepts, techniques and approaches used to develop, implement and succeed in entrepreneurial projects. Students will work in multidisciplinary teams to design and apply projects to real-world problems. The problems will be identified and selected from a wide range of interest areas, including, health, education, agriculture, technology and industrial and community services. Projects must be aligned with students’ knowledge and skills acquired during their previous university study. The course is composed of modules that provide students with the required skills for capstone projects design and implementation, such as problem identification, project management, leadership, teamwork and professional skills, product and patent research, systems analysis and design methodologies, prototyping and proof of concept methods.
